Can you put a baby gate in a doorway? When you are mounting a safety gate on a doorway, you can choose either a pressure mounted or a wall mounted safety gate. The two types are equally safe, so the choice will come down to whether or not you wish to drill into your doorframe.

What is the difference between a pet gate and a baby gate? Generally speaking, baby gates tend to consist of the same types of metal, plastic, and other materials found in dog and puppy gates. The main difference between the two is in the overall strength of their designs. In baby gates, for example, materials tend to be much lighter in weight than what’s found in puppy gates.

Can dogs knock down free standing gates?
As we just mentioned, high energy dogs and large breed dogs can easily topple a freestanding pet gate. No matter the quality or weight, if a dog gate is not properly installed into a wall, it can easily come down.
Are freestanding dog gates safe?
Freestanding pet gates are not recommended for large breeds, as well as some cheap pressure-mounted pet gates. Hardware-mounted dog gates are best, but some more expensive pressure-mounted pet gates will work as well.
Are pet gates OK for babies?
Generally, freestanding pet gates are great for puppies and little dogs, but they aren’t suitable for babies unless there is constant supervision. Pressure mounted gates aren’t recommended for stairs because they can be pushed out of place by children and animals.
Does a baby gate work for dogs?
It’s also advised to avoid using a baby gate instead of a dog one. A child safety gate may be flimsy and not as sturdy or strong as a dog gate, which means it could collapse, making it unsafe and unsuitable for your dog.
Can I put a baby gate at the top of the stairs?
Safety Tip #1: Hardware-Mounted is Safest
A gate at the top of the stairs that isn’t hardware-mounted creates the risk of being pushed over by a child, causing an injury. When installing a gate at the top of the stairs, always make sure the gate swings toward the landing and not out over the stairs.

Where should you put a baby gate in your house?
It’s ideal to install safety gates at the top and bottom of stairs, but the top is the most critical spot. The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ission recommends choosing safety gates that must be screwed into the walls or handrails for the tops of stairs.

How do you hang a baby gate without studs?
If there are no studs available where you want to mount it, you can open up the wall and either install a stud at that location, or depending on how the gate mounts, you might be able to add bracing between two existing studs and then mount to that.
How tall does a baby gate need to be?
To discourage an adventurous child from climbing over a gate, the one you buy should be at least three-quarters of your child’s height. (Gates must be at least 22 inches high.)

Are baby gates a fire hazard?
Baby gates are a necessary evil. If the baby gates open with not much more difficulty than a standard door, then it will be judged to be OK. Office of the State Fire Marshal recommends using the hinged baby gates so it won’t become an obstruction by falling on the floor or becoming displaced.
How long should you use baby gates?
Install gates in homes with children between 6 months and 2 years of age. If possible, remove the gates when the child turns 2, or when the child has learned to open the gate or climb over it.
Does a 3 year old need a stair gate?
EU guidelines say you should stop using stair gates when your child is 2 years old. They may be able to climb over or dislodge the gate at that age and injure themselves. Remove the gates sooner if your child is able to climb over them. When a child is old enough, show them how to slowly and safely clim b the stairs.
